    • The visibility of an application for an end user in the Launchpad or Mobile Client is determined by two factors:
      • 1. The user needs to have the execute permission for the application in question assigned to them either via global role or business role within the scope of a project.
      • 2. Additionally, every application that allows anonymous usage as configured in the security settings of the App Designer, will be visible to the users.
    • As you’re executing the Login App Wizard in newly created applications, all such apps are going to allow anonymous usage per default. Therefore those apps will all be visible to the users.
    • Currently, the only way to avoid this behaviour would be to either not use the Login App Wizard to begin with or, alternatively, adapt the configuration made by the Wizard and remove anonymous usage from the application once again. In the latter case, please keep in mind though that you’d have to make further changes in the process flow of your application as the generated logic from the wizard tries to dynamically add the existing SSO providers to the login mask. The retrieval of those SSO providers is no longer going to work then.
    • We do plan to adapt the platform behaviour in a future release so that the execute permission for a given application should be the only deciding factor when determining the visibility of applications for end users. In order to facilitate this change, we’ve asked you to create a feature request in our Ideas portal for this matter.
